Output 317582ba8461ec15bc74958e089aaecc059829e20406bcc75c532b2827b14800:42

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 69ccb70a8f47e87d1f5482a9b209859d04bff4953c46eb4cd244327b1462bed2
address
bc1pd8xtwz50gl586865s25myzv9n5ztlay483rwknxjgse8k9rzhmfqntff5l
transaction
317582ba8461ec15bc74958e089aaecc059829e20406bcc75c532b2827b14800
spent
true